| @@ -129,6 +129,24 @@ class InfoExtractor(object): | ||||
|         webpage_bytes = urlh.read() | ||||
|         return webpage_bytes.decode('utf-8', 'replace') | ||||
|          | ||||
|     #Methods for following #608 | ||||
|     #They set the correct value of the '_type' key | ||||
|     def video_result(self, video_info): | ||||
|         """Returns a video""" | ||||
|         video_info['_type'] = 'video' | ||||
|         return video_info | ||||
|     def url_result(self, url, ie=None): | ||||
|         """Returns a url that points to a page that should be processed""" | ||||
|         #TODO: ie should be the class used for getting the info | ||||
|         video_info = {'_type': 'url', | ||||
|                       'url': url} | ||||
|         return video_info | ||||
|     def playlist_result(self, entries): | ||||
|         """Returns a playlist""" | ||||
|         video_info = {'_type': 'playlist', | ||||
|                       'entries': entries} | ||||
|         return video_info | ||||
